As Alive As You Need Me To BeNine Inch Nails8rank/position

A monumental track crafted by the American heavyweights who redefined industrial rock, Nine Inch Nails! Released in July 2025, this song serves as the lead single for the soundtrack of the film TRON: Ares.
The industrial texture woven by distorted synth bass and mechanical beats is quintessentially their forte, and yet the melodious, vocoder-processed vocals carry a certain wistfulness that unmistakably hints at a respectful nod to Daft Punk, who composed for earlier entries in the series.
The lines searching for something to believe in sound exactly like the cry of a program awakening to self-awareness in a digital world.

What Have You Done?Nine Inch Nails9rank/position

Nine Inch Nails, known as the pioneers who pushed industrial rock into the mainstream, were inducted into the Rock & Roll Hall of Fame in 2020—truly a legendary band.
They’re the ones behind the soundtrack album for the film TRON: Ares, released in September 2025: Tron: Ares (Original Motion Picture Soundtrack).
This piece is one of the tracks included on that album.
Built entirely from electronic sounds, its chilly sonic landscape swells into an outburst of emotion in the latter half before abruptly fading away—a fleeting structure that brilliantly captures regret and nihilism.
It’s perfect not only for those who want to immerse themselves in NIN’s signature dark aesthetic, but also for listeners seeking a short, intensely impactful experience.

You Know What You Are?Nine Inch Nails10rank/position

This track, a song by the American rock band Nine Inch Nails, features a stunning hands-and-feet combination that really explodes.
The intro is built entirely from a sixteenth-note phrase constructed with just the bass drum and snare combination.
Being able to play such a long hands-and-feet combo with pinpoint precision is seriously cool.
From a drummer’s perspective, it’s a very catchy intro that really sticks in your ears.
